Fertilizing is fundamental to supporting plant health and achieving rich, lively landscapes. Plants need a well balanced supply of nutrients-- mostly n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- to grow strong roots, produce plentiful blossoms, and preserve lively foliage. A soil test is the first step in identifying what nutrients are lacking, making sure that the selected fertilizer satisfies the specific needs of the website. Fertilizers are available in different types, including granular, liquid, organic, and artificial, each offering various release rates and benefits. Applying the ideal type at the correct time is necessary to avoid nutrient runoff, root burn, or unequal development. Seasonal timing, such as using higher nitrogen in the spring and more potassium in the fall, assists plants get ready for development spurts or stand up to winter season tension. Constant fertilization not only improves plant appearance however likewise enhances resilience against insects, illness, and ecological stressors. A well-fed landscape is most likely to flourish year after year, providing both appeal and eco-friendly worth
